KÁLIDÁSA. – Horace Hayman WILSON (translator). The Mégha Dúta; or, Cloud Messenger: A Poem, in the Sanscrit Language. Calcutta: P. Pereira, at the Hindoostanee Press, 1813. First edition in English, 4to (297 x 232mm.) Half-title, text in English and Sanskrit, 2pp. ‘Errata’, 3pp. publisher’s ‘Advertisement’ to rear. (Spotting to endpapers.) Contemporary navy blue straight-grain morocco, Greek key gilt borders (extremities rubbed, some scuffing). Note: considered to be Kálidása’s greatest poem, it recounts how a yaksa (a nature spirit) is banished into exile for a year. The yaksa convinces a passing cloud to take a message to his wife. It began the tradition of the ‘messenger poem’.
